Spacecraft repair services focus on diagnosing and resolving technical issues affecting satellite components such as propulsion systems, communication payloads, power units, and onboard software. Upgrade services, on the other hand, aim to enhance performance through hardware replacements, software enhancements, and integration of advanced technologies.
The expansion of global satellite networks is a key growth factor. Communication, navigation, defense, and earth observation satellites form the backbone of modern digital infrastructure. Any malfunction can disrupt critical services, making timely repair and upgrade capabilities essential. By addressing issues in orbit, operators can avoid the high costs associated with launching replacement satellites.
Technological advancements have significantly improved repair feasibility. Robotic servicing vehicles equipped with precision tools can perform intricate repairs in space. Modular spacecraft designs allow easier component replacement and system integration. Predictive maintenance technologies also enable early fault detection, reducing mission downtime.
Commercial space enterprises are increasingly investing in spacecraft upgrade solutions to stay competitive. Upgrading satellites with enhanced processing capabilities, advanced sensors, or improved propulsion systems allows operators to adapt to evolving market demands. Such upgrades extend mission life and increase return on investment.
Governments are also driving demand, particularly for defense and scientific missions. Upgrading surveillance satellites or scientific instruments ensures improved data accuracy and operational readiness. These services contribute to national security and technological leadership.
